1. What is Generic Zebeta (Bisoprolol)?
Generic Zebeta is the non-branded version of the drug Zebeta, which contains the active ingredient bisoprolol fumarate. Bisoprolol belongs to a class of medications called beta-adrenergic blockers, or simply beta-blockers. These drugs work by blocking the effects of adrenaline (epinephrine) on the heart and blood vessels, thereby reducing heart rate, blood pressure, and the heart's workload.
2. Mechanism of Action
Bisoprolol selectively blocks beta-1 adrenergic receptors, which are predominantly located in the heart. By inhibiting these receptors, it:
Reduces Heart Rate: Slows down the heart rate, allowing the heart to pump more efficiently.
Lowers Blood Pressure: Decreases the force of contraction and the volume of blood pumped, reducing pressure on the arterial walls.
Decreases Myocardial Oxygen Demand: Reduces the heart's need for oxygen, which is particularly beneficial for patients with angina or heart failure.
Unlike non-selective beta-blockers, bisoprolol has a higher affinity for beta-1 receptors, minimizing effects on beta-2 receptors in the lungs and blood vessels. This selectivity reduces the risk of side effects such as bronchospasm, making it safer for patients with respiratory conditions.
3. Therapeutic Uses
Generic Zebeta is prescribed for several cardiovascular conditions, including:
Hypertension (High Blood Pressure): Bisoprolol helps lower blood pressure, reducing the risk of stroke, heart attack, and kidney damage.
Chronic Heart Failure: It is often used in combination with other medications to improve symptoms and prolong survival in patients with heart failure.
Angina Pectoris: By reducing the heart's workload, bisoprolol alleviates chest pain associated with reduced blood flow to the heart muscle.
Arrhythmias: It helps stabilize irregular heart rhythms, particularly those caused by excessive adrenaline activity.
4. Dosage and Administration
The dosage of Generic Zebeta varies depending on the condition being treated, the patient's age, and their overall health. Typical dosages include:
Hypertension: 5–10 mg once daily.
Heart Failure: Initially, 1.25 mg once daily, gradually increased to 10 mg as tolerated.
Angina: 5–10 mg once daily.
Bisoprolol is usually taken orally, with or without food. It is important to follow the prescribing physician's instructions and not to stop the medication abruptly, as this can lead to rebound hypertension or worsening angina.
5. Side Effects
Like all medications, Generic Zebeta can cause side effects, although not everyone experiences them. Common side effects include:
Fatigue
Dizziness
Headache
Cold hands and feet
Nausea
Diarrhea
Serious but rare side effects may include:
Severe bradycardia (slow heart rate)
Worsening heart failure
Shortness of breath or wheezing (due to bronchospasm)
Depression or mood changes
Masking of hypoglycemia symptoms in diabetic patients
Patients should seek immediate medical attention if they experience chest pain, fainting, or severe allergic reactions.
6. Precautions and Contraindications
Before starting Generic Zebeta, patients should inform their healthcare provider about their medical history, especially if they have:
Asthma or ch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D)
Diabetes
Liver or kidney disease
Peripheral vascular disease
A history of allergic reactions to beta-blockers
Bisoprolol is contraindicated in patients with:
Severe bradycardia
Heart block greater than first degree (without a pacemaker)
Cardiogenic shock
Severe heart failure (unless stabilized)
7. Drug Interactions
Generic Zebeta can interact with other medications, potentially altering their effects or increasing the risk of side effects. Notable interactions include:
Calcium Channel Blockers: May cause excessive lowering of heart rate and blood pressure.
Insulin and Oral Hypoglycemics: Bisoprolol can mask hypoglycemia symptoms and alter blood sugar control.
NSAIDs: May reduce the antihypertensive effects of bisoprolol.
Digoxin: Increases the risk of bradycardia.
Clonidine: Abrupt withdrawal of clonidine while on bisoprolol can lead to severe hypertension.
Patients should always inform their doctor about all medications, supplements, and herbal products they are taking.
8. Advantages of Generic Zebeta
Cost-Effective: As a generic medication, bisoprolol is significantly more affordable than its branded counterpart, making it accessible to a larger population.
Proven Efficacy: Extensive clinical trials and real-world use have demonstrated its effectiveness in managing cardiovascular conditions.
Once-Daily Dosing: Convenient dosing improves patient adherence to treatment.
9. Limitations and Considerations
Not Suitable for All Patients: Individuals with certain conditions, such as severe asthma or uncontrolled heart failure, may not be candidates for bisoprolol.
Gradual Titration Required: Patients with heart failure require careful dose adjustments to avoid worsening symptoms.
Withdrawal Risks: Abrupt discontinuation can lead to rebound hypertension or angina.

What is the correct way to take this medication?
This medication should be taken orally with a full glass of water. This medication can be taken with or without meals, whichever you want. Always remember to space out your dosages evenly. Do not take your medication more frequently than recommended by the label. It is not safe to quit taking this medication all of a sudden. This has the potential to have devastating repercussions on the heart.
Have a discussion with your child's physician about the possibility of giving them this medication. It's possible that further attention is required.
In the event that you believe you may have taken an excessive amount of this medication, you should immediately contact a poison control center or an emergency facility.
PLEASE TAKE NOTE That no one else should use this medication. It is important that others not use this medication.
What should I do if I forget a dose?
If you forget to take a dosage, you should take it as soon as you remember it. Take only that dose if it is getting close to the time for your next scheduled dose. Do not take the recommended dose in double or excess amounts.

What side effects should I be on the lookout for when using this medication?
You should schedule frequent checkups with your primary care physician or another qualified medical expert. When you are taking this medication, you should get your heart rate and blood pressure checked on a frequent basis. Consult your primary care physician or another qualified medical practitioner about the appropriate ranges for your heart rate and blood pressure, as well as the appropriate time to follow up with them.
You may become tired or dizzy. Do not get behind the wheel of a vehicle, operate heavy machinery, or engage in any activity that requires mental alertness until you have determined how this medicine affects you. Take it easy when getting up, especially if you are an older patient who needs medical attention. This lowers the likelihood of experiencing periods of lightheadedness or fainting. Drinking alcohol can amplify both drowsiness and lightheadedness. Steer clear of alcoholic beverages.
This medication may have an effect on the levels of sugar in the blood. If you have diabetes, you should talk to your primary care physician or another qualified medical practitioner before making any adjustments to your diabetes medication or diet.
While you are taking this medication, you should not self-medicate for coughs, colds, or discomfort without first consulting your physician or another qualified medical expert for guidance. There is a possibility that some of the substances will raise your blood pressure.
